- Joined
- Jul 10, 2008
- Messages
- 384
these are the coolest looking roaches I have ever seen, anyone heard of them?
http://uglyoverload.blogspot.com/2008/03/bug-for-you.html


http://uglyoverload.blogspot.com/2008/03/bug-for-you.html